What is a 25-Inch Electric Fireplace Heater Stove?
A 25-inch electric fireplace heater stove is a compact and stylish heating solution that blends the realistic appeal of a traditional fireplace with modern electric technology. Typically, these units feature a fireplace flame simulation, allowing for a cozy atmosphere without the hassle of logs, smoke, or ash. They are designed to fit easily into small spaces while still offering effective heating capabilities, often capable of warming an area of up to 400 square feet.

Key Features to Look for in a 25-Inch Electric Fireplace Heater Stove
When considering the purchase of a 25-inch electric fireplace heater stove, it is essential to evaluate the features that will best suit your needs:
- Heat Output: Check the unit's heat output measured in British Thermal Units (BTUs). Most models range between 4,600 to 5,200 BTUs.
- Flame Effects: Look for models with realistic flame effects that can be adjusted for brightness and color.
- Remote Control: Some units come with remotes, allowing for seamless operation from a distance.
- Adjustable Thermostat: A thermostat can help regulate room temperature and improve energy efficiency.
- Design and Style: Choose a unit that matches your interior design, whether you prefer a classic stove look or a modern aesthetic.
How to Install a 25-Inch Electric Fireplace Heater Stove
Installation of a 25-inch electric fireplace heater stove is straightforward and does not require professional assistance. Follow these steps for successful installation:
- Select the Right Location: Find a location near a power outlet, ensuring the stove is at least three feet away from flammable materials.
- Level Surface: Ensure the surface where the stove will stand is level to maintain stability and safety.
- Check the Outlet: Plug the stove into a grounded outlet. Avoid using extension cords, as these can pose a fire hazard.
- Safety Precautions: Make sure to read the manufacturer's instructions and safety guidelines before operating the unit.
- Test the Features: Once plugged in, test various features, including the flame effects and thermostat settings.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How much electricity does a 25-inch electric fireplace heater stove use?
Electric fireplaces are generally energy efficient. A typical 25-inch electric stove uses anywhere from 1,500 watts during operation, which translates to roughly £0.15 to £0.30 per hour, depending on local electricity rates.
2. Can I leave an electric fireplace heater stove on overnight?
While many electric fireplace heater stoves are designed with safety features, such as overheat protection, it is advisable to turn off the unit when leaving the home or going to sleep to avoid potential risks.
3. Are electric fireplace heater stoves safe for children and pets?
Yes, electric fireplace heater stoves are designed with safety features such as cool-to-touch surfaces and automatic shut-off systems to enhance safety around children and pets. However, it is always wise to supervise young children and pets around any heating device.
4. Do I need to vent an electric fireplace heater stove?
No, one of the significant advantages of electric fireplace heater stoves is that they do not require venting. They operate on electricity, creating no smoke or emissions, making them suitable for any room.
5. Can an electric fireplace heater stove be used for zone heating?
Yes, they are excellent for zone heating. This allows homeowners to heat specific areas of the house, effectively reducing overall heating costs by relying less on central heating systems.
